Output 96539a1988a81dee6b863b954f72a8c2044c77a7d0b1be6ea0215ce4f6939c18:1

value
43856
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d74863c8c6d8af156c1ec3afc05d600e3a490816 OP_EQUAL
address
3MKKvWyHmuhAcz3hdAezWd1126P4ahaPwN
transaction
96539a1988a81dee6b863b954f72a8c2044c77a7d0b1be6ea0215ce4f6939c18